---
title: NEProviderStopReason.authenticationCanceled
framework: networkextension
role: symbol
role_heading: Case
path: networkextension/neproviderstopreason/authenticationcanceled
---

# NEProviderStopReason.authenticationCanceled

The authentication process was canceled.

## Declaration

```swift
case authenticationCanceled
```

## See Also

### Stop Reasons

- [NEProviderStopReason.none](networkextension/neproviderstopreason/none.md)
- [NEProviderStopReason.userInitiated](networkextension/neproviderstopreason/userinitiated.md)
- [NEProviderStopReason.providerFailed](networkextension/neproviderstopreason/providerfailed.md)
- [NEProviderStopReason.noNetworkAvailable](networkextension/neproviderstopreason/nonetworkavailable.md)
- [NEProviderStopReason.unrecoverableNetworkChange](networkextension/neproviderstopreason/unrecoverablenetworkchange.md)
- [NEProviderStopReason.providerDisabled](networkextension/neproviderstopreason/providerdisabled.md)
- [NEProviderStopReason.configurationFailed](networkextension/neproviderstopreason/configurationfailed.md)
- [NEProviderStopReason.idleTimeout](networkextension/neproviderstopreason/idletimeout.md)
- [NEProviderStopReason.configurationDisabled](networkextension/neproviderstopreason/configurationdisabled.md)
- [NEProviderStopReason.configurationRemoved](networkextension/neproviderstopreason/configurationremoved.md)
- [NEProviderStopReason.superceded](networkextension/neproviderstopreason/superceded.md)
- [NEProviderStopReason.userLogout](networkextension/neproviderstopreason/userlogout.md)
- [NEProviderStopReason.userSwitch](networkextension/neproviderstopreason/userswitch.md)
- [NEProviderStopReason.appUpdate](networkextension/neproviderstopreason/appupdate.md)
- [NEProviderStopReason.connectionFailed](networkextension/neproviderstopreason/connectionfailed.md)
